Printer Printing Blank Pages?

If paper comes out but no ink or toner appears, these two control tests will tell you whether the problem is inside the printer or on the computer.

Run two tests

Test 1: no computer

Print the printer's built-in report

Use the control panel to print a nozzle check, supplies report, configuration page, or quality report. The name varies by model.

If this is blank: focus on ink, toner, cartridge installation, print-head flow, or printer hardware.

Test 2: from another app

Print a known PDF from the computer

Print our black-and-white test from a browser or PDF viewer. Check the preview, selected pages, paper size, and output mode.

If only this is blank: focus on the source document, application, driver, or print settings.

Match your result to the next action

Test resultLikely areaWhat to do next
Built-in report is completely blankPrinter or consumableCheck cartridge seating, required shipping seals, supply status, and the model's maintenance guide.
Nozzle check has some colors but misses othersSpecific ink channelCheck that cartridge, then run one normal head cleaning and re-test.
Built-in report is clean; one document is blankDocument or applicationCheck print preview, hidden/white content, page range, and try a simple PDF from another app.
Built-in report is clean; every computer job is blankDriver or print settingsRemove the print queue, install the current manufacturer driver, and add the printer again.
Blank sheets occur between printed sheetsDocument, duplex, or paper feedInspect blank pages in preview, disable separator sheets, verify size/duplex, and reload dry flat paper.

Blank pages with a new cartridge

  1. 1. Confirm the exact cartridge: compare its code with the printer manual and its assigned slot.
  2. 2. Follow the installation card: remove only the shipping pieces it identifies. A blocked air vent can stop ink flow.
  3. 3. Reseat it once: power down only if the manufacturer directs it, then reinstall until properly latched.
  4. 4. Print the built-in check: this bypasses the document and most computer-side causes.

Frequently asked questions

Why is my printer printing blank pages even though it has ink?

The ink-level estimate can be wrong, a cartridge vent or protective seal can still be blocked, the cartridge may not be seated correctly, or dried ink may be blocking the print-head nozzles. Print the printer's built-in nozzle check to separate ink-delivery problems from computer or driver problems.

Why does the printer's built-in test print but my documents are blank?

A clean built-in test means the print engine can place ink or toner on paper. The likely cause then moves to the application, document, page range, driver, or print settings. Try a simple PDF from another application and install the current manufacturer driver if the issue persists.

Can a new cartridge cause blank pages?

Yes. Check that every shipping seal and protective tape specified by the manufacturer was removed, the cartridge is in the correct slot, and it clicked fully into place. Do not remove labels or seals that the installation guide says to leave attached.

Why does my printer insert blank pages between printed pages?

Intermittent blank sheets are more often caused by an extra blank page in the document, an incorrect paper-size or duplex setting, separator pages, or multiple sheets feeding together. Check the print preview and fan the paper before changing cartridges.

Should I keep running print-head cleaning until ink appears?

No. Run one normal cleaning and print another nozzle check. If the pattern improves, one additional cycle may help. Stop if two cycles show no improvement because repeated cleaning uses substantial ink and may not fix a failed cartridge or print head.
